Transaction 657f3587b3de57c45650652423c64c31c326d0392b81a3123d61bd88ff321a09

26 Input
2 Outputs
  • 657f3587b3de57c45650652423c64c31c326d0392b81a3123d61bd88ff321a09:0
  • value  1000139
    address  1EFnfyUZspE7MEBuCwn7BnSgaXnkBhvAN7
  • 657f3587b3de57c45650652423c64c31c326d0392b81a3123d61bd88ff321a09:1
  • value  400000000
    address  34CXdppn47FPmwEYNFH4EtT2A4BawyrMec